In this paper,we consider the initial-boundary value problem for some nonlinear higher-order viscoelastic Kirchhoff type equations.By using Banach contraction fixed point theorem,we study the existence and uniqueness of local solutions for some higher-order viscoelastic Kirchhoff type equations with source terms.Meanwhile,the blow-up and lifespan estimates of solutions are also given according to Lyapunov inequality.By means of energy estimation method and the continuous boundedness criterion,we prove the existence of global solutions for higher-order viscoelastic Kirchhoff equation with damping term and establish the decay property of global solutions by applying the difference inequality due to Nakao. |
